Designing a small bathroom and laundry room combo is an exercise in height optimization and smart appliance selection. The first priority must be the appliances: a compact vent-free dryer paired with a space-saving washer is often the best choice, as it eliminates the need for an exterior dryer vent and has a smaller overall footprint. Utilizing the space over the washer and toilet with deep, closed cabinets is crucial for keeping laundry and cleaning gear neatly tucked. Floating shelves work, but cabinets keep the necessary clutter contained, which is essential for tight spaces. Incorporate multi-functional elements—for instance, a wall-mounted ironing board that folds flat against the wall, or a extendable shelf over machines. Every piece in a small combo must have multiple functions.

Laundry in Bathroom Design Polk County FL
Placing laundry in bathroom design is a time-tested strategy for efficiency, but it must be done carefully to avoid dampness issues. High humidity is the enemy of wood cabinetry and appliance lifespan. Therefore, using waterproof finishes is crucial. Choose cabinetry made from marine-grade plywood or specialized laminate, and ensure all electrical connections meet safety standards and are water-secure. A smart feature is a wall-mounted drop-down counter. It’s perfect for sorting or folding clothes but can be secured vertically when not in use, preserving precious floor space and maintaining the bathroom’s open feel. This attention to mechanical and material detail ensures the setup lasts and operates flawlessly.

Bathroom Laundry Room Design Polk County FL
In the realm of bathroom laundry room design, sound control and vibration control are often underestimated but critically important factors. A washing machine during its spin cycle can be noisy, especially in an otherwise quiet bathroom. To mitigate this, consider installing the washer and dryer on a sturdy platform or on a layer of sound-dampening material before tiling the floor. Opting for appliances specifically designed for silent function also helps immensely. From a design perspective, guarantee the laundry area has a drainage tray or a slight slope toward a floor drain, especially if you have an upstairs unit. This minor feature offers crucial safety against accidental spills, preserving your property and giving you peace of mind.

Bathroom Laundry Room Design Ideas Polk County FL
The most effective bathroom laundry room design ideas integrate convenience right into the structure. A fantastic feature is the laundry chute if your bathroom is located on a floor above the washing machine. If that’s not possible, consider a built-in laundry sorter with multiple tilt-out bins integrated into the nearby cabinet. These are labeled for 'lights', 'colors', and 'delicates', streamlining laundry prep and concealing mess. A design that defines distinct areas, even without a physical wall, through the use of different tile patterns or textures, can also enhance the room's overall structure and aesthetic appeal.
